About Me
What is your educational background?
I'm currently pursuing a Bachelor's degree in Internet of Things (IoT) at Madhav Institute of
Technology and Science (MITS), Gwalior. I'm part of the 2027 graduating batch and constantly
working to enhance my skills in software development, AI integration, and database management.
What programming languages do you know?
I'm proficient in several programming languages including C, C++, JavaScript, Python, and
HTML/CSS for web development. I also work with frameworks like React and Django. You can find a
complete list of my technical skills in the Skills section of my portfolio.
Are you available for freelance projects?
Yes! I'm open to freelance opportunities in web development, AI integration projects, and
database management. Feel free to reach out through the Contact form with project details, and
I'll get back to you to discuss how I can help bring your ideas to life.
Technical Skills
What GenAI tools do you work with?
I work with various GenAI tools including LangChain and LangFlow for building AI applications. I
also have experience with data visualization tools like PowerBI to present insights in an
accessible way. I'm constantly exploring new AI technologies to enhance my skills.
What databases do you have experience with?
I have hands-on experience with both SQL and NoSQL databases including MySQL, MongoDB, and
AstraDB. I can design, implement, and optimize database systems for web applications and ensure
efficient data storage and retrieval.
How do you approach web scraping projects?
My approach to web scraping involves using tools like Selenium and BeautifulSoup in Python. I
focus on ethical scraping practices, respect for robots.txt files, and structuring the collected
data efficiently. My Flipkart Data Extractor project demonstrates these skills in a real-world
application.
Projects & Work
Can you tell me more about your Virtual Lab project?
The Virtual Lab is an interactive educational tool I developed that allows students to explore
voltage, current, and resistance relationships through simulations. It provides a safe, hands-on
digital environment for learning circuit behavior without requiring physical components. You can
review the project through the link in my Projects section.
What technologies did you use for the InfiAi project?
InfiAi is built using a combination of Langflow for AI workflow management, Streamlit for the
front-end interface, AstraDB for data storage, and Python as the core programming language. It's
designed to enhance social media interactions through intelligent content generation and
personalized recommendations.
Do you have any experience with mobile app development?
No, I don't have experience with mobile app development at the moment, but I'm a quick learner
and eager to expand my skills in this area in the future.
Contact & Collaboration
How can I contact you for project inquiries?
You can reach me through the Contact form on my portfolio website, or directly via email at
ayan.ahmedkhan591@gmail.com. I'm also available on LinkedIn and GitHub - links to these
platforms are provided in the footer of my website.
What is your typical timeline for completing projects?
Project timelines vary based on scope and complexity. For small to medium-sized web development
projects, I typically aim for completion within 1-2 weeks. For larger projects or those
involving complex AI integration, timelines may extend to 3-4 weeks. I'll provide a detailed
timeline estimate after discussing your specific project requirements.
Are you open to remote collaboration?
Absolutely! I'm comfortable with remote collaboration and have experience working with
distributed teams using tools like Git for version control, Slack for communication, and project
management platforms like Trello or Jira. I'm flexible with schedules and can adapt to different
time zones if needed.